Deep Dive into Barrier Component Stress Testing
The core of my audit is a granular analysis of each component. This is where I find the issues that lead to unexpected failures.
Gate Latch & Hinge Load Analysis: I don't just check if the gate latches. I use a tension gauge to test the self-closing mechanism. It must have sufficient force to close and latch from any position, a common failure point as springs weaken in the constant humidity. The latch must be mounted on the poolside of the gate, at least 54 inches from the bottom. For magnetic latches, I specifically check for corrosion bleed, a frequent problem in coastal properties, which can reduce the magnetic pull by over 30% in a single year.
Barrier Permeability Mapping: The state code specifies that a 4-inch sphere cannot pass through any opening in the fence. I've seen homeowners in communities like The Concession fail because decorative landscaping or a newly installed AC unit provided an unintentional climbing point near the barrier. My mapping process identifies these non-obvious "climbable zones" and ensures the vertical and horizontal members of the fence are spaced correctly to prevent scaling.
Alarm System Decibel & Battery Redundancy Test: If using door or window alarms as a safety layer, they must emit a sound of at least 85 decibels at 10 feet. I use a decibel meter to confirm this. More importantly, I simulate a power outage—a critical test given our hurricane season—to ensure the battery backup system activates instantly and can sustain the alarm's function.
My Pre-Inspection Implementation Checklist
Before you schedule your official inspection, I perform a rigorous final check. This checklist is the practical application of my audit and has consistently resulted in a first-pass certification for my clients. You can use it to self-assess your own pool area.
Gate Swing & Latch: Open the gate to various degrees, from one inch to fully open. It must self-close and self-latch every single time without manual assistance.
Shake Test: Firmly shake every section of your fence or barrier. There should be no excessive give, and no pickets should come loose. This simulates both wear-and-tear and a child attempting to force their way through.
Measure All Gaps: Use a 4-inch diameter ball or a tape measure. Check the space between vertical pickets and the clearance between the bottom of the fence and the ground. The clearance under the fence cannot exceed 4 inches.
Confirm All Entry Points: Every single door and window providing direct access from the home to the pool must have a compliant alarm or a self-closing/latching device installed. This is a frequently overlooked requirement in homes with multiple sliding glass doors opening onto the lanai.
Check Hardware Integrity: Look for any signs of rust or corrosion on screws, hinges, and latches. In Manatee County, this is not just a cosmetic issue; it's a structural one. Replace any compromised hardware immediately with marine-grade stainless steel.
Precision Tuning for Manatee County's Environment
Achieving certification is one thing; maintaining it is another. I always advise clients on material choices that withstand our specific local conditions. For instance, opting for powder-coated aluminum or vinyl fencing over wood significantly reduces maintenance. For hardware, I insist on 316-grade stainless steel for any property east of I-75 and especially for those on the islands. The upfront cost is marginal compared to the cost of replacing rusted, failed hardware and failing a future inspection. This simple material choice can increase the functional lifespan of your gate hardware by up to 70% in our coastal climate.
